/** \details
An IfcBlobTexture provides a 2-dimensional distribution of the lighting parameters of a surface onto which it is mapped.
The texture itself is specified as a single binary blob, representing the content of a pixel format file.
The file format of the pixel file is specified by the RasterFormat attribute.
*/
